Senate bill looks to clarify DOE authority over advanced reactors
Sen. Mike Lee (R., Utah), chair of the Senate Committee on Energy and Natural Resources (ENR), has introduced a bill that would grant the Department of Energy greater authority over new nuclear projects under the federal agency’s oversight.

Duke Energy, a Fortune 150 company, is headquartered in Charlotte, N.C. The company has approximately 51,000 megawatts of generating capacity in the Carolinas (including 11,000 megawatts of nuclear generation), Midwest and Florida, providing electricity to 7.8 million customers, and natural gas services supplying more than 1.6 million customers in Ohio, Kentucky, Tennessee and the Carolinas.
